In 2022 it's 150 years ago the famous Dutch painter Piet Mondriaan was born in Amersfoort.
Lots of activities in the city - such as this crosswalk in Mondriaan style - to commemorate this.
I waited for some people to enliven the scene and was lucky when this colourful group crossed.
